If it would help, here are the texts (and a little from commentators) for this week's lesson (I do this every week for myself and others in the church who find it convenient):

Memory Text: Luke 24:5-6 KJV “Why seek ye the living among the dead? 6 He is not here, but is risen.”

Sunday, February 20 Precursors

Matthew 11:5 KJ21 “the blind receive their sight and the lame walk, the lepers are cleansed and the deaf hear, the dead are raised up and the poor have the Gospel preached to them.”
Mark 5:35-43 KJ21 “35 ¶ While He yet spoke, there came from the ruler of the synagogue’s house certain ones who said, "Thy daughter is dead; why troublest thou the master any further?" 36 As soon as Jesus heard the word that had been spoken, He said unto the ruler of the synagogue, "Be not afraid; only believe." 37 And He suffered no man to follow Him, save Peter and James and John, the brother of James. 38 And He came to the house of the ruler of the synagogue, and saw the tumult and those who wept and wailed greatly. 39 And when He had come in, He said unto them, "Why make ye this ado and weep? The damsel is not dead, but sleepeth." 40 And they laughed Him to scorn. But when He had put them all out, He took the father and the mother of the damsel and those who were with Him, and entered in where the damsel was lying. 41 And He took the damsel by the hand and said unto her, "Talitha cumi," which is, being interpreted, "Damsel, I say unto thee, arise." 42 And straightway the damsel arose and walked, for she was of the age of twelve years. And they were astonished with a great astonishment. 43 And He charged them strictly that no man should know about it, and commanded that something should be given her to eat.”
Luke 7:11-17 KJ21 “11 ¶ And it came to pass the day after, that He went into a city called Nain; and many of His disciples went with Him, and many people. 12 Now when He came nigh to the gate of the city, behold, there was a dead man being carried out, the only son of his mother, and she was a widow. And many people of the city were with her. 13 And when the Lord saw her, He had compassion on her and said unto her, "Weep not." 14 And He came and touched the bier, and those who bore him stood still. And He said, "Young man, I say unto thee, arise." 15 And he that was dead sat up and began to speak. And He delivered him to his mother. 16 And there came a fear on all, and they glorified God, saying, "A great prophet is risen up among us"; and, "God hath visited His people." 17 And this report of Him went forth throughout all Judea and throughout all the region round about.”
John 11:1-46 KJ21 (selected portions) “1 ¶ Now a certain man was sick named Lazarus, of Bethany, the town of Mary and her sister Martha. 3 Therefore his sisters sent unto Him, saying, "Lord, behold, he whom Thou lovest is sick." 17 ¶ Then when Jesus came, He found that he had lain in the grave four days already. 18 Now Bethany was nigh unto Jerusalem, about two miles away, 19 and many of the Jews came to Martha and Mary to comfort them concerning their brother. 20 Then Martha, as soon as she heard that Jesus was coming, went and met Him; but Mary sat still in the house. 21 Then Martha said unto Jesus, "Lord, if Thou hadst been here, my brother would not have died. 22 But I know that even now, whatsoever Thou wilt ask of God, God will give it Thee." 23 Jesus said unto her, "Thy brother shall rise again." 24 Martha said unto Him, "I know that he shall rise again at the resurrection on the Last Day." 25 Jesus said unto her, "I am the Resurrection and the Life. He that believeth in Me, though he were dead, yet shall he live; 26 and whosoever liveth and believeth in Me shall never die. Believest thou this?" 27 She said unto Him, "Yea, Lord, I believe that Thou art the Christ, the Son of God, who should come into the world." 28 And when she had so said, she went her way and called Mary her sister secretly, saying, "The Master has come, and calleth for thee." 32 Then when Mary had come where Jesus was and saw Him, she fell down at His feet, saying unto Him, "Lord, if Thou hadst been here, my brother would not have died." 33 ¶ When Jesus therefore saw her weeping, and the Jews also weeping who came with her, He groaned in the spirit and was troubled, 34 and said, "Where have ye laid him?" They said unto Him, "Lord, come and see." 35 Jesus wept. 36 Then said the Jews, "Behold, how he loved him!" 37 And some of them said, "Could not this man, who opened the eyes of the blind, have caused that even this man should not have died?" 38 Jesus therefore again, groaning in Himself, came to the grave. It was a cave, and a stone lay against it. 39 Jesus said, "Take ye away the stone." Martha, the sister of him that was dead, said unto Him, "Lord, by this time there is a stench, for he hath been dead four days." 40 Jesus said unto her, "Said I not unto thee that if thou would believe, thou should see the glory of God?" 41 Then they took away the stone from the place where the dead was laid. And Jesus lifted up His eyes and said, "Father, I thank Thee that Thou hast heard Me. 42 And I knew that Thou hearest Me always, but because of the people who stand by I said it, that they may believe that Thou hast sent Me." 43 And when He thus had spoken, He cried with a loud voice, "Lazarus, come forth!" 44 And he that was dead came forth, bound hand and foot with graveclothes, and his face was bound about with a napkin. Jesus said unto them, "Loose him, and let him go."

Monday, February 21 The Resurrected Christ

Matthew 28:9 God’s Word “Suddenly, Jesus met them and greeted them. They went up to him, bowed down to worship him, and took hold of his feet.”
Luke 24:33-49 MKJV “33 And they rose up the same hour and returned to Jerusalem and found assembled the Eleven and those with them. 34 And they said, the Lord has indeed risen, and has appeared to Simon. 35 And they told what things [had happened] in the way, and how He had been known by them in breaking of the loaf. 36 ¶ And as they spoke this, Jesus Himself stood in their midst, and said to them, Peace to you! 37 But they were terrified and filled with fear, for they thought they saw a spirit. 38 And He said to them, Why are you troubled, and why do thoughts arise in your hearts? 39 Behold My hands and My feet, that I am He! Handle Me and see, for a spirit does not have flesh and bones as you see Me have. 40 And when He had spoken this, He showed them [His] hands and feet. 41 And while they still did not believe for joy, and wondered, He said to them, Have you any food here? 42 And they handed to Him a piece of a broiled fish and of a honeycomb. 43 And He took [it] and ate before them. 44 And He said to them, These [are] the words which I spoke to you while I was still with you, that all things must be fulfilled which were written in the law of Moses and in the Prophets and [in] the Psalms about Me. 45 And He opened their mind to understand the Scriptures. 46 And He said to them, So it is written, and so it behoved Christ to suffer and to rise from [the] dead the third day, 47 and that repentance and remission of sins should be proclaimed in His name among all nations, beginning at Jerusalem. 48 And you are witnesses of these things. 49 And behold, I send the promise of My father on you. But you sit in the city of Jerusalem until you are clothed with power from on high.”
John 20:10-23 MKJV “10 Then the disciples went away again to themselves. 11 ¶ But Mary stood outside of the tomb, weeping. And as she wept, she stooped down into the tomb. 12 And [she] saw two angels in white sitting there, the one at the head and the other at the feet, where the body of Jesus had lain. 13 And they said to her, Woman, why do you weep? She said to them, Because they have taken away my Lord, and I do not know where they have laid Him. 14 And when she had said this, she turned backward and saw Jesus standing, but she did not know that it was Jesus. 15 Jesus said to her, Woman, why do you weep? Whom do you seek? Supposing Him to be the gardener, she said to Him, Sir, if you have carried Him away from here, tell me where you have laid Him and I will take Him away. 16 Jesus said to her, Mary! She turned herself and said to Him, Rabboni! (which is to say, Master!) 17 Jesus said to her, Do not touch Me, for I have not yet ascended to My Father. But go to My brothers and say to them, I ascend to My Father and Your Father, and [to] My God and your God. 18 Mary Magdalene came and told the disciples that she had seen the Lord and that He had spoken these things to her. 19 ¶ Then the same day at evening, being the first [day] of the sabbaths, when the doors were shut where the disciples were assembled for fear of the Jews, Jesus came and stood in the midst, and said to them, Peace to you! 20 And when He had said this, He showed them [His] hands and His side. Then the disciples were glad when they saw the Lord. 21 Then Jesus said to them again, Peace to you. As [My] Father has sent Me, even so I send you. 22 And when He had said this, He breathed on [them] and said to them, Receive [the] Holy Spirit. 23 Of whomever sins you remit, they are remitted to them. Of whomever [sins] you retain, they are retained.”
John 21:1-14 NKJV “1 ¶ After these things Jesus showed Himself again to the disciples at the Sea of Tiberias, and in this way He showed [Himself]: 2 Simon Peter, Thomas called the Twin, Nathanael of Cana in Galilee, the [sons] of Zebedee, and two others of His disciples were together. 3 Simon Peter said to them, "I am going fishing." They said to him, "We are going with you also." They went out and immediately got into the boat, and that night they caught nothing. 4 But when the morning had now come, Jesus stood on the shore; yet the disciples did not know that it was Jesus. 5 Then Jesus said to them, "Children, have you any food?" They answered Him, "No." 6 And He said to them, "Cast the net on the right side of the boat, and you will find [some]." So they cast, and now they were not able to draw it in because of the multitude of fish. 7 Therefore that disciple whom Jesus loved said to Peter, "It is the Lord!" Now when Simon Peter heard that it was the Lord, he put on [his] outer garment (for he had removed it), and plunged into the sea. 8 But the other disciples came in the little boat (for they were not far from land, but about two hundred cubits), dragging the net with fish. 9 Then, as soon as they had come to land, they saw a fire of coals there, and fish laid on it, and bread. 10 Jesus said to them, "Bring some of the fish which you have just caught." 11 Simon Peter went up and dragged the net to land, full of large fish, one hundred and fifty-three; and although there were so many, the net was not broken. 12 Jesus said to them, "Come [and] eat breakfast." Yet none of the disciples dared ask Him, "Who are You?" ——knowing that it was the Lord. 13 Jesus then came and took the bread and gave it to them, and likewise the fish. 14 This [is] now the third time Jesus showed Himself to His disciples after He was raised from the dead.”
Acts 1:4-9 NRSV “4 While staying with them, he ordered them not to leave Jerusalem, but to wait there for the promise of the Father. "This," he said, "is what you have heard from me; 5 for John baptized with water, but you will be baptized with the Holy Spirit not many days from now." 6 ¶ So when they had come together, they asked him, "Lord, is this the time when you will restore the kingdom to Israel?" 7 He replied, "It is not for you to know the times or periods that the Father has set by his own authority. 8 But you will receive power when the Holy Spirit has come upon you; and you will be my witnesses in Jerusalem, in all Judea and Samaria, and to the ends of the earth." 9 When he had said this, as they were watching, he was lifted up, and a cloud took him out of their sight.”

Tuesday, February 22 Witnesses From the Grave

Matthew 27:52-53 Weymouth “52 the tombs opened; and many of God’s people who were asleep in death awoke. 53 And coming out of their tombs after Christ’s resurrection they entered the holy city and showed themselves to many.”

Wednesday, February 23 Paul and the Resurrection of Jesus

1 Corinthians 15:3-8 ESV “3 For I delivered to you as of first importance what I also received: that Christ died for our sins in accordance with the Scriptures, 4 that he was buried, that he was raised on the third day in accordance with the Scriptures, 5 and that he appeared to Cephas, then to the twelve. 6 Then he appeared to more than five hundred brothers at one time, most of whom are still alive, though some have fallen asleep. 7 Then he appeared to James, then to all the apostles. 8 Last of all, as to one untimely born, he appeared also to me.”

Thursday, February 24 Resurrection, Now and Then

John 5:24-25 ASV “24 Verily, verily, I say unto you, He that heareth my word, and believeth him that sent me, hath eternal life, and cometh not into judgment, but hath passed out of death into life. 25 Verily, verily, I say unto you, The hour cometh, and now is, when the dead shall hear the voice of the Son of God; and they that hear shall live.”
Romans 6:4-6 Darby “4 We have been buried therefore with him by baptism unto death, in order that, even as Christ has been raised up from among [the] dead by the glory of the Father, so *we* also should walk in newness of life. 5 For if we are become identified with [him] in the likeness of his death, so also we shall be of [his] resurrection; 6 knowing this, that our old man has been crucified with [him], that the body of sin might be annulled, that we should no longer serve sin.”

SDA BIBLE DICTIONARY, article “Resurrection” – “It was the certainty of Christ’s resurrection that brought point and power to the preaching of the gospel. Peter speaks of “the resurrection of Jesus Christ from the dead” as producing a “lively hope” in believers. It was their [the apostles] personal knowledge of “the resurrection of the Lord Jesus” that gave “great power” to their witness).”
